Kansas City University Joplin LogoA Kansas City University Joplin is a private not-for-profit school in Joplin, Missouri with about 640 students employees.

Our Safety Report for this school is based on the US Department of Education 2023 public data sets for various categories of violent and non-violent crimes committed both on-campus and off-campus over the last three years.

Safety Evaluation

According to our analysis of the government data, Kansas City University Joplin is a safe place to stay. American School Search gives this school grade "A" on safety.

From our perception of the data, this campus experiences no significant crime problems.
